Job Description
Employee Contract Type: Local - Open Ended Employee
Job Description: Liaison with government organization
Liaise with Immigration Office, MOFA and Broadcasting Authority for entry visa and Journalist visa for incoming guests. Record and update the status of visa and passports and give update to guests and staffs
Process pre-authorization of NGO visa and visa extension where online processing is not applicable
Process media pre-authorization visa for media crew and make sure WVE is aligned with airport custom requirements
Process VIP saloon and airport pass requests.
Support on processing passports, visas, yellow fever cards, and requisite travel documents for WV Ethiopia international travelers
Record and update visa requirements, embassy locations, and related information
Liaise with different government officer in relation with internet, telephone, utility, facility etc.
Guest Handling
Provide airport pick-up/drop off for VIP guests
Assist in arranging hotel shuttles for guests and timely pick/drop off
Assist in liaise between Administration, host and security departments to make sure guests are picked up from the hotel, have security briefing and meet with host departments
Administration Support
Support in preparation of invitation letters, hotel booking, shuttle arrangement, air ticket, event booking and all related activities in guest handling.
Support in bill settlement of different services such as accommodation, event, air ticket, cafeteria
Ensure timely settlement of bills related with passport issuance and visa fee on time.
Assist in prepare monthly report on NGO visa pre-authorization for incoming visitors, passport and visa processing for internal staff.
Assist in updating visitor’s calendar on a daily basis
Cover Administration coordinators for travel and guest relations positions whenever is necessary.
other assignments given by the supervisor.
